Spine Coral
Hydnophora exesa
- Group: Coral
- Typical depth: 0–40 m
- IUCN status: LC
A reef coral whose surface bristles with raised cones, the spine coral is an aggressive neighbour that attacks corals crowding too close. Its polyps spread by day, and barnacles often take up residence across its rough surface.
Taxonomy: Animalia › Cnidaria › Hexacorallia › Scleractinia › Merulinidae › Hydnophora
